Copper-catalyzed oxidative trimerization of indoles by using TEMPO to construct quaternary carbon centers: the synthesis of 2-(1H-indol-3-yl)-2,3′-biindolin-3-ones
A simple, convenient, and efficient synthesis of 2-(1H-indol-3-yl)-2,3′-biindolin-3-one derivatives has been developed by the oxidative trimeric reaction of indoles using the TEMPO/CuCl 2 catalyst system under ambient air.
